欢迎访问新91视频 - 高清资源每日更新

别再问17c2能不能用,别忽略:别急着更新,先搞懂它为什么会变

频道:轻松围观站 日期: 浏览:139

别再问17c2能不能用,别忽略:别急着更新,先搞懂它为什么会变

别再问17c2能不能用,别忽略:别急着更新,先搞懂它为什么会变

每次有新版本出来,总有人第一反应就是“能不能用?”然后把问题简化成二选一:要么马上更新,要么干脆不动。对产品经理、运维工程师或开发者来说,这种二元思维会带来不必要的风险和不确定性。与其匆忙做决定,不如先弄清楚:17c2到底是什么,它为什么会变,变了会带来哪些影响,然后再制定有把握的升级策略。

版本变动的常见原因

  • 安全修复:应急修补已知漏洞,往往需要优先考虑。
  • Bug 修复:修复某个场景下的异常,但可能带来回归风险。
  • 性能优化:提升吞吐或减少资源消耗,但可能改变行为时序。
  • 依赖升级:底层库升级会影响兼容性或引入新接口。
  • 功能/接口变更:API、配置项或默认值调整会破坏现有集成。
  • 构建/环境差异:不同编译器、构建参数或 CI 环境会导致行为差异。
  • 法规/合规调整:为满足监管要求而修改特性或数据处理逻辑。

直接忽视这些原因会带来什么后果?

  • 兼容性问题:第三方集成、客户端或数据库可能不兼容。
  • 回归和新 bug:看似修复的问题在其它场景复现或引入新问题。
  • 性能波动:响应时间、内存、CPU 使用异常波动。
  • 数据损坏或迁移失败:变更数据模型可能导致数据丢失或迁移错误。
  • 运维负担上升:紧急回滚、补丁、沟通会占用大量资源。
  • 安全风险:拖延关键安全补丁会把系统暴露在威胁下。

决定是否更新的实用判断框架 1) 看发布说明(不是只看版本号)

  • 找出有没有“breaking changes”“security fixes”“migration steps”。
  • 关注与自己使用路径相关的条目,而非全部内容。

2) 查证社区与厂商反馈

  • 关注 issue 列表、论坛和社交媒体的实际用户报告。
  • 优先关注与你技术栈相同或相似场景的反馈。

3) 评估影响面

  • 哪些服务、哪些客户会受到影响?
  • 有没有数据迁移或回滚成本?
  • 是否会影响合规或监控报警阈值?

4) 备份与回滚方案确认

  • 没有可靠回滚方案就不要盲目推进。
  • 确认数据库快照、配置备份与部署回退路径。

5) 制定测试与发布策略(见下文)

一套可复制的测试与上线流程

  • 在和生产尽可能一致的预发布环境中进行验证。包含相同的配置、相同规模(或按比例扩展)、相同依赖版本。
  • 自动化测试覆盖率优先:单元测试、集成测试、端到端测试、回归测试都要跑一遍。
  • 性能基准比较:关键事务的延迟、吞吐、资源占用进行对比测试。
  • 灰度或 Canary 发布:先对少量流量或少量用户发布,观察若干天指标是否稳定。
  • 设置自动化报警:错误率、延迟、资源使用、业务关键指标一旦异常立即告警并自动触发回滚策略(如果配置了)。
  • 用户验收测试(UAT):让真实业务方或 QA 人员在预生产环境验证关键路径是否正常。

上线后的监控清单(需要持续关注的指标)

  • 错误率(400/500 系列响应)
  • 平均与 P95/P99 响应时间
  • 资源使用:CPU、内存、磁盘 I/O、网络带宽
  • 数据一致性与迁移进度(如果有)
  • 第三方依赖的健康情况(数据库、消息队列、外部 API)
  • 客户反馈与支持工单数量

发生回归或异常怎么办

  • 先停止扩展发布,回退到上一稳定版本(前提是有可行回滚方案)。
  • 收集可复现步骤、日志、堆栈信息与性能快照,尽量把问题限定到最小范围。
  • 与上游厂商或开源社区沟通,开 issue 并附上复现用例和日志。
  • 如果回退不可行,尽快制定临时补救措施(feature flag、流量限制、降级处理)以减轻影响。
  • 汇总经验教训,更新发布流程与自动化检查项,避免同类问题重演。

实践建议(让决策更靠谱、更低风险)

  • 在 CI/CD 中把依赖版本固定,避免“无意识”自动升级带来的惊喜。
  • 对关键系统采用蓝绿或滚动升级策略,减少单点风险。
  • 把每次升级视为项目:有计划、有负责人、有回滚验收。
  • 定期对预发布环境做“灾难演练”,确认回滚与备份流程真实可用。
  • 把升级日志和策略文档化,便于团队复用与审计。

结束语 “17c2能不能用”不是一个可以用一句话回答的问题。更有效的做法是理解版本改动的性质、评估对自己环境的影响、用可控的发布流程验证风险并准备好回滚与应急方案。这样做比盲目更新或长期拖延都要稳妥得多——既能保护业务稳定性,也能在必要时尽快享受到修复与优化带来的好处。

关键词:再问17c2能不